Class Actress  & en co-vedette: Penguin Prison

Description en anglais seulement

Class Actress is a Brooklyn-based synthpop trio, consisting of singer-songwriter Elizabeth Harper and producers/keyboardists Scott Rosenthal and Mark Richardson. Initially, Harper pursued a career as an indie rock musician in Los Angeles, but upon hearing a remix by Richardson of one of her songs, she favored the electronic production over the acoustic original and decided to relocate to Brooklyn to collaborate with Richardson.

There, the duo transformed Harper's previous guitar-based sound into more synth-driven instead, which consequently formed Class Actress. Soon after formation, Rosenthal joined the group. They took their name from a joke about Harper's former choice to pursue drama major in college.

Penguin Prison is Chris Glover from New York, who first rose to prominence with a college band called “The Smartest People at Bard”, whose demos came to the attention of Q-Tip and, through him, Interscope. A solo album for the Universal label followed in 2009 but it attracted scant attention, so in the same year Glover left, took up the new moniker and began gaining recognition with remixes, amongst others, for Goldfrapp, Marina & the Diamonds, Passion Pit.
